Hi everybody. This was the first message I landed on just now when opening my email program again. Anyways...I just read about this group earlier today over on the i-devices group and figured I'd join. As for a little bit about myself, I've been blind since birth and live in a suburb of Chicago, so you'd think I'd be keen on transportation and travel and all that, right? Well not exactly but things are starting to improve especially with the acquisition of my iPhone about 2 years ago. I could sing the praises of the iPhone with VoiceOver probably forever. But to cut right to the chase, I started using Uber last year with the help of a sighted tutor. I've had no problems with the service itself, or Lyft which I've used a few times as well. The Uber app seems to get along pretty well with VoiceOver, but I've had some issues. I think this is due in part to my slow typing on the phone, but that will improve over time. I've since had a number of ongoing social engagements which have more or less eaten up my time, so I haven't done as much with my iPhone as I probably should. But I do have some 3rd-party apps on there in addition to Uber. I don't currently have the Lyft app, but hopefully I can find the time to get it soon. I think that's all from me for now. More later.
